hello all …
android is becoming very strong this days !! i have an sm-j610f with android 8.1 D the FRP lock is on and the phone is protected by pattern … i found an ENG sboot on the intrenet

https://shell.boxwares.com/Download.aspx?L=8431

anyway i upload it via odin to enable ADB … then i used Octoplus box t reset FRP (log)

Resetting FRP lock..
FRP lock is successfully reseted!
Goto "Menu->Settings->Backup and reset" and make "Factory
data reset"
Performed by 2.7.7.5 Software version.

but is ask for Factory reset to complete the process ( is there anyway to bypass this step ? and wny other idea to bypass the pattern ?
